FIVE SUSPECTED NPA REBELS – Five suspected NPA rebels were killed in an encounter in the municipality of Mabinay, Negros Oriental.

According to a report from ABS-CBN News, the Philippine Army reported that they received information from a resident in Sitio Talingting, Barangay Luyang that a wanted man was with a grouup of armed men in two houses in tbe area.

As the said suspects were approached by authorities who carried a warrant of arrest, a gunfight ensued. this lead to the death of 5 suspects, among them were Sayas Ribilista who has an arrest warrant.

Retrieved from the suspects were 3 M16 rifles, onew AK-47, one caliber 45 pistol, some magazines, 4 rifle grenades, one improvised explosive, ammo and subversive documents of high-intelligence value.

Based on the report, last year, authorities linked the NPA with an incident involving the torture and slaying of four policemen, an attorney and his wife, and some residents in the eastern province of Negros.
